Heres the problem
I have a 91 DX hatch. Usually I have my ZC in it, but right now Im running a SOHC d16a6 (91 usdm Si). I have the feeling my distributor has taken a dump.
Basicly in the last few months, I have gone through 2 cap and rotors. The reason for this is the fact that the rotor svrew is coming breaking off. The third one Im on now isnt breaking the screws, the screw is acually coming out. Now it may have just not been tightend properley, so we'll see. But here is the issue thats scaring me the most. The RPM gauge is now jumping all over the place. Its seems to do it for a while until it gets warmed up. The motor isnt acually chaging RPMS, just the needle is jumping like crazy. I have been told this is a sign that the dristubutor is done. My question, is it acually done and I need a whole new one, or is the somthing else I can check before I spend the money on a new distributor?
